The Path of Tantra
For fifteen centuries, several realized Masters of the tantric path used the crucible of their own bodies and lives to develop a powerful tradition; a tradition that requires the courage to engage your body, your human desires and your most challenging life-obstacles as the basic ?fuel? for insight and as an accelerated means to enlightenment.
 
Yatha Bramhand Tatha Pind ? which means all that is contained in the Whole is contained in the part. Tantra is the play of the dual principles: the conscious-unconscious, male-female, in breath-out breath, night and day, sun and moon, love and hate, heat and cold, birth and death, within each individual. One cannot exist without the other.
 
Tantra is made up of two syllables, tanoti, which means ?expansion? and trayati, ?liberation?; the expansion of mind and the liberation of energy from the clutches of matter to spirit. At the heart of Tantra is the union of the Male Shiva and his consort, the Female Shakti. Tantric texts are, in essence, the eavesdropping on a conversation between lovers, Parvati, the primordial energy and Shiva, the primordial consciousness. He is Grace and She, receptivity. This is the ultimate symbol of Tantra; the sacred weaving of polarities which melt into one unified whole. .
 
According to Tantra, the universal consciousness descends towards manifestation as individual consciousness, assuming four states known as buddhi, manas, chitta and Ahamkara. Buddhi represents the higher intellect with its activity of viveka or discrimination; manas is the lower mind with its characteristic leanings towards sankalpa- vikalpa or thoughts and counter-thoughts (duality).
